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your home and assess the damage, identifying the source of the problem and developing a plan to extract the water and dry out your home.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ect moisture and identify areas of concern.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ring a smooth restoration process.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using advanced equipment, our team will extract the water from your home, reducing further damage and preventing secondary damage from mold and mildew. We’ll work quickly and efficiently to get the water out, and then move on to the drying process.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, our team will focus on drying out your home. We’ll use specialized equipment to remove moisture from the air and surfaces, ensuring your home is safe and secure. This step is critical in preventing m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fecting
With the water and moisture under control, our team will focus on cleaning and disinfecting your home. We’ll remove any affected materials, and then sanitize and disinfect all surfaces to prevent the spread of bacteria and other contaminants.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Once the cleaning and disinfecting process is complete, our team will work with you to restore and reconstruct your home. This may involve repairing or replacing damaged materials, and then making any necessary repairs to ensure your home is safe and secure.

Residential Water Extraction Cost In Brecksville, OH
The cost of Residential Water Extraction in Brecksville, OH, will v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500, but this can vary depending on the specifics of your situ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ting | $500 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Restoration and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, materials needed |
| Equipment Rental and Use | $500 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|
| Monitoring and Testing | $200 – $500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ment needed |

Q: How do I prevent water damage in my home?
A: There are several steps you can take to prevent water damage in your home, including regularly inspecting your roof, pipes, and appliances, and addressing any issues quickly. You should also consider installing a sump pump and backup power source in your basement or crawlspace, and keeping an eye out for signs of moisture buildup or water damage.
